Table II.F.12.c Among private-sector enrollees with single coverage: Percent in a non-high deductible health insurance plan with mixed providers where a gatekeeper is required by firm size and State: United States, 2018
Division and State Total Less than 10 employees 10-24 employees 25-99 employees 100-999 employees 1000 or more employees Less than 50 employees 50 or more employees
United States 3.4%    4.7%    4.7%    3.8%    3.7%    2.8%    4.3%    3.2%   
New England:
Connecticut 1.2% * 3.5% * 6.9% * 0.0%    0.0%    1.0% * 3.4% * 0.6% *
Maine 1.8% * 3.1% * 0.7% * 2.7% * 2.0% * 1.3% * 2.1% * 1.7% *
Massachusetts 4.1% * 0.0%    3.7% * 3.3% * 4.4% * 4.6% * 2.6% * 4.5% *
New Hampshire 1.4% * 0.0%    0.0%    1.2% * 3.8% * 0.6% * 0.3% * 1.7% *
Rhode Island 2.9% * 0.0%    22.0% * 3.3% * 2.4% * 0.6% * 8.9% * 1.3% *
Vermont 3.5% * --    10.0% * 5.2% * 3.4% * 0.3% * 7.3% * 2.5% *
Middle Atlantic:
New Jersey 4.8%    11.8% * 10.4% * 0.2% * 4.7% * 4.4% * 7.9% * 4.0% *
New York 2.2%    9.7% * 2.1% * 6.5% * 1.3% * 0.5% * 5.4% * 1.5% *
Pennsylvania 3.8%    10.3% * 2.1% * 6.1% * 4.4% * 2.6% * 4.5% * 3.7% *
East North Central:
Illinois 2.4% * 0.0%    0.0%    8.5% * 4.1% * 0.1% * 2.5% * 2.3% *
Indiana 4.6% * 0.0%    3.7% * 5.6% * 6.2% * 3.9% * 1.4% * 5.2% *
Michigan 5.0% * 5.2% * 0.0%    0.3% * 9.1% * 4.9% * 1.6% * 5.4% *
Ohio 2.9% * 8.8% * 1.0% * 1.1% * 5.2% * 2.5% * 3.6% * 2.8% *
Wisconsin 3.8% * --    0.0%    2.6% * 4.3% * 3.3% * 4.6% * 3.7% *
West North Central:
Iowa 3.6% * 1.4% * 2.6% * 7.7% * 6.5% * 0.9% * 3.8% * 3.6% *
Kansas 5.4%    2.4% * 2.2% * 5.2% * 3.7% * 7.1%    5.4% * 5.4%   
Minnesota 1.5% * 0.0%    7.1% * 0.4% * 0.0%    1.9% * 2.2% * 1.4% *
Missouri 4.5%    0.0%    0.0%    0.0%    9.6% * 4.7% * 0.0%    5.3%   
Nebraska 5.0% * 8.6% * --    5.6% * 1.3% * 6.1% * 11.1% * 4.3% *
North Dakota 4.3% * 2.9% * 6.3% * 3.9% * 4.6% * 4.3% * 6.4% * 3.8% *
South Dakota 1.6% * 0.0%    0.0%    0.0%    4.5% * 1.0% * 0.0%    2.0% *
South Atlantic:
Delaware 1.3% * --    2.1% * 5.0% * 0.0%    0.6% * 5.2% * 0.4% *
District of Columbia 3.0% * 15.6% * 9.3% * 2.5% * 2.3% * 1.1% * 8.2% * 1.8% *
Florida 0.9% * 2.2% * 1.4% * 0.8% * 0.4% * 0.9% * 1.2% * 0.8% *
Georgia 2.9%    11.2% * 0.0%    1.9% * 1.2% * 3.4% * 4.2% * 2.8% *
Maryland 4.7% * 3.3% * 0.0%    3.7% * 13.5% * 1.9% * 3.6% * 5.0% *
North Carolina 3.2% * 0.0%    2.0% * 1.5% * 4.4% * 3.4% * 2.1% * 3.3% *
South Carolina 2.9% * --    0.0%    9.3% * 3.1% * 1.5% * 4.0% * 2.7% *
Virginia 3.2% * 3.0% * 10.8% * 3.2% * 2.5% * 2.6% * 6.8% * 2.5% *
West Virginia 8.9%    --    7.9% * 15.9% * 0.8% * 10.1% * 10.6% * 8.5% *
East South Central:
Alabama 3.8% * --    0.0%    5.8% * 5.6% * 3.0% * 3.0% * 4.0% *
Kentucky 2.3% * 5.3% * 2.4% * 8.6% * 1.0% * 1.5% * 7.1% * 1.4% *
Mississippi 8.9%    --    0.0%    0.1% * 6.4% * 13.1% * 4.3% * 9.9% *
Tennessee 0.5% * --    0.0%    0.0%    0.6% * 0.6% * 0.7% * 0.5% *
West South Central:
Arkansas 9.0%    --    27.0% * 9.9% * 17.2% * 5.4% * 8.1% * 9.1%   
Louisiana 4.5%    --    3.8% * 6.8% * 2.0% * 4.0% * 8.1% * 3.7%   
Oklahoma 5.6% * 0.0%    11.7% * 0.0%    6.1% * 7.8% * 3.8% * 6.1% *
Texas 2.9% * 1.2% * 0.8% * 5.2% * 2.5% * 3.0% * 0.7% * 3.3% *
Mountain:
Arizona 2.5% * --    1.4% * 0.0%    0.6% * 4.3% * 0.5% * 2.9% *
Colorado 2.0% * 0.0%    0.0%    0.0%    3.8% * 2.2% * 0.0%    2.5% *
Idaho 6.1% * --    0.0%    18.3% * 0.5% * 6.6% * 0.5% * 7.9% *
Montana 5.6% * 5.0% * 11.5% * 10.6% * 5.5% * 1.0% * 10.2% * 4.0% *
Nevada 2.9% * --    --    1.9% * 4.3% * 2.2% * 5.3% * 2.5% *
New Mexico 2.4% * --    0.0%    6.4% * 1.1% * 2.1% * 3.6% * 2.1% *
Utah 4.7% * --    6.8% * 5.2% * 0.5% * 5.6% * 8.3% * 4.3% *
Wyoming 2.7% * --    8.0% * 8.2% * 1.7% * 1.0% * 3.6% * 2.4% *
Pacific:
Alaska 5.9%    22.0% * 8.5% * 4.9% * 5.2% * 3.6% * 11.8% * 4.4% *
California 3.9%    4.6% * 12.5% * 1.6% * 3.5% * 3.3% * 7.0%    3.1%   
Hawaii 9.0%    16.1% * 14.4% * 15.7% * 10.2% * 2.2% * 13.5%    7.3% *
Oregon 6.7%    9.1% * 14.4% * 7.6% * 2.8% * 6.9% * 13.4% * 4.6% *
Washington 4.2% * 1.3% * 2.2% * 9.0% * 8.3% * 1.7% * 6.4% * 3.6% *

Source: Agency for Healthcare Research and Quality, Center for Financing, Access and Cost Trends. 2018 Medical Expenditure Panel Survey-Insurance Component.

Note: Definitions and descriptions of the methods used for this survey can be found in the Technical Appendix.

* Figure does not meet standard of reliability or precision.

-- Data suppressed due to high standard errors or few reported values in cell.
